Recently I bought a couple of old Mamiya RB67 lenses to use with a Fotodiox adaptor on my Nikon D800E. This is one of the first shots I took with the 127mm f/3.5 lens.
This particular part of Shinagawa, down towards the Konan Exit of the JR railway station, has some amazing light towards the end of the day; streaming in from the large windows at the top of a large atrium in the building.
Great spot to shoot with the backlight at that time of day.
This lens setup is not light but it produces some great results.
